Near the main cache is a huge tree that has been hit by lightning but is still standing even though the trunk is hollow,well worth a look,it seems to defy gravity

Pogles Wood was an old "watch with mother programme" from the sixties which i obviously cant remember ( cough ) and the woodland this cache is in has been called that by locals for as long as i remember.Myself and my good mate Kid Curry along with various other Streetly waifs and strays used to build bonfires and experiment with everything you are not supposed to as 12-15 year olds here ( happy days ),neither of us have grown up and are now in our mid 40s and when we planted this cache it was a real walk down memory lane and i think we were both tempted to get a fire going and crack a couple of cans.
